Missouri State to invest more money into Lady Bears coaching staff after NCAA Tournament run

Following the departure of head coach Kellie Harper in the wake of an NCAA Tournament Sweet 16 appearance, it appears Missouri State is going to invest more money into its new Lady Bears coaching staff.

New head coach Amaka Agugua-Hamilton's staff is slated to make more money than Harper's staff did before the majority of it departed for Tennessee.

The Missouri State University Board of Governors is expected to approve the contracts for the new Lady Bears assistant coaches on Friday.

Harper's assistant coaching staff in its final season made $257,487 between Jon Harper, Jessica Jackson and Jackie Stiles when you don't include the additional $20,000 Stiles received for promotional compensation.
